LAFAYETTE HIGH SCHOOL
Lafayette High School is a Title I public high school that is part of the Fayette County school district, located in Lexington, KY with about 2,293 students offering grade levels from 9th Grade to 12th Grade. Student demographics can be found below.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 124 teachers, Lafayette High School has a student/teacher ratio of about 18: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.
Lafayette High School, located in Lexington, Kentucky, is a prominent public secondary school within the Fayette County Public Schools district. Known for its strong academic reputation and deep-rooted traditions, the school serves a diverse student body and is recognized for offering a wide range of extracurricular opportunities, including competitive athletics, fine arts programs, and various student-led clubs. It is frequently highlighted as a cornerstone of the local community, emphasizing both scholastic achievement and the development of well-rounded students.
Beyond its standard curriculum, Lafayette is notably home to the prestigious School for the Creative and Performing Arts (SCAPA) at Lafayette, a specialized program that draws students from across the county who excel in fields such as dance, drama, music, and visual arts. This integration of a rigorous academic environment with high-level arts training makes the school a unique hub for creative talent. With its long history in Lexington, Lafayette High School remains a significant institution dedicated to preparing its graduates for post-secondary success while maintaining a vibrant and inclusive school culture.
